On June 30, 1908, a comet
fragment
collided with the
Earth's atmosphere over
Russian Siberia.
The great
fireball was brighter than the
Sun. The energy was equal
30 Megaton explosion.
|
|
In July 1994,
Shoemaker-Levy 9 comet fragments collided with Jupiter and released 200
million Megatons TNT.
